Inspirational Birthday Wishes

  • “They say it’s your birthday / We’re gonna have a good time / I’m glad it’s your birthday / Happy birthday to you.” — The Beatles, “Birthday”
  • “The great thing about getting older is that you don’t lose all the other ages you’ve been.” — Madeleine L’Engle
  • “I hope you don’t mind, I hope you don’t mind / That I put down in words / How wonderful life is / While you’re in the world.” — Elton John, “Your Song”
  • “Let us never know what old age is. Let us know the happiness time brings, not count the years.” — Ausonius
  • “The way I see it, you should live every day like it's your birthday.” — Paris Hilton
  • “Every year on your birthday, you get a chance to start new.” — Sammy Hagar

Funny Birthday Quotes

  • “I have always been regretting that I was not as wise as the day I was born.” — Henry David Thoreau
  • “Although it is generally known, I think it’s about time to announce that I was born at a very early age.” — Groucho Marx
  • “Life would be infinitely happier if we could only be born at the age of eighty and gradually approach eighteen.” — Mark Twain
  • “Eventually you reach a point when you stop lying about your age and start bragging about it.” — Will Rogers
  • “The secret of staying young is to live honestly, eat slowly, and lie about your age.” — Lucille Ball

Thoughtful Birthday Wishes

  • “We turn not older with years, but newer every day.”— Emily Dickinson
  • “Age is whatever you think it is. You are as old as you think you are.” — Muhammad Ali
  • “The soul is born old but grows young. That is the comedy of life.” — Oscar Wilde
  • “Age does not depend upon years, but upon temperament and health. Some men are born old, and some never grow so.” — Tryon Edwards
  • “We grow neither better nor worse as we get old, but more like ourselves.” — Bernard Baruch
  • “Count your age by friends, not years. Count your life by smiles, not tears.” — John Lennon
